Exactly what is a Servo Motor?
A servo electric motor is a rotary actuator that is designed for exact precision control. It consists of a power motor, a feedback gadget, and a controller. They could accommodate complex movement patterns and profiles much better than any additional type of engine. Although they are little in size they can pack a whole lot of power, and are extremely energy efficient.
There are two types of servo motors, AC servos and DC servos. The primary difference between your two motors is certainly their way to obtain power. AC servo motors rely on an electric wall plug, rather than batteries like DC servo motors. While DC servo electric motor performance is dependent just on voltage, AC servo motors are reliant on both frequency and voltage. Because of the complexity of the energy supply, AC
servo motors are designed for high surges, which explains why they are often found in industrial machinery.
Why Choose an AC Servo Electric motor?
There are several benefits to choosing AC servo motors over DC servo motors. They provide more torque per weight, efficiency, reliability and decreased radio frequency sound. And in the absence of a commutator, they might need less maintenance and also have a longer life span.
